Abstract

It is suggested symmetric relative to particles and antiparticles formulation of the Dirac theory, in which the states with negative energy are excluded. The fields of particles and antiparticles are associated with the wave functions, for which there is valid the Born interpretation of being the probability amplitudes. In doing so, one eliminates different kinds of "paradoxes" in the theory, which existence is caused by an incorrect account of the states with negative energy.
